您的位置:首页 > 技术中心 > PHP教程 >
  • PHP5和PHP7的垃圾回收机制有什么不同

    php5和php7的垃圾回收机制都是利用引用计数,由于PHP是用C来写的,C里面有一种东西叫做结构体,我们PHP的变量在C中就是用这种方式存储的。今天我们就来学习一下PHP5和PHP7的垃圾回收机制的不同。php5和php7的垃圾回收机制都

    2022-02-23 17:40点击阅读

  • 分析PHP底层内核源码之变量 (三)

    本篇文章给大家介绍《分析PHP底层内核源码之变量 (三)》。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。相关文章推荐:《解析PHP底层内核源码之变量 (一)》《分析PHP底层内核源码之变量 (二) zend_string

    2022-02-23 17:40点击阅读

  • php7如何借鉴其他框架,写出自己的框架

    框架的核心链路是从开始的请求路由解析到控制器的分发,model的数据交互到响应。使用其他的框架实现会非常的笨重,集成的内容太多,很多都不需要用到,所以借鉴其他框架写了一个简单实用的框架。先从路由开始来说:1)路由路由协议的规则是使用了正则表

    2022-02-23 17:40点击阅读

  • php7中创建扩展的方法是什么

    PHP扩展是编译库,它允许在您的PHP代码中使用特定的功能。今天我们就来给大家介绍一下php创建一个扩展的方式,有需要的小伙伴可以参考参考。将实现如下功能:输出内容:$ php ./test.php$ h

    2022-02-23 17:40点击阅读

  • 深入解析PHP底层之Running process

    本篇文章带大家深入解析一下PHP Running process。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。PHP的底层语言是C语言 C语言是编译型 语言。 编译型语言:程序在执行之前需要一个专门的编译过程,把程

    2022-02-23 17:40点击阅读

  • Centos7下php7如何安装zip扩展

    本篇文章给大家介绍一下Centos7下php7安装zip扩展的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。安装:yum install -y php-devel #用于编译cd /usr/local/srcwget

    2022-02-23 17:40点击阅读

  • nginx服务器如何从php5.5.7升级到php7?

    本篇文章给大家介绍一下nginx服务器从php5.5.7升级到php7?的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。①、服务器nginx 、php 、mysql都是安装好的,于是想直接升级php7.②按照文章:h

    2022-02-23 17:38点击阅读

  • 一分钟玩转PHP7新特性

    话说当年追时髦,php5和php7共存,立马写了个超级耗时间的循环脚本测了一番,确实php7给力很多,然后也是注意了一些新增的特性与一些丢弃掉的用法。 关于这些新增的特性,我们还是需要一起去了解吧前言 主要研究问题: 1.PHP7带来的好处

    2022-02-23 17:38点击阅读

  • MAC如何使用php7搭建LNMP环境

    本篇文章给大家介绍一下MAC使用php7搭建LNMP环境的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。1、安装MySQL:查看MySQL可用版本信息:brew info mysql我这边看到的版本是5.7.10:m

    2022-02-23 17:38点击阅读

  • centos7下如何安装php7的openssl扩展

    openssl作为系统核心扩展之一,通过对内容进行私钥加密和公钥解密的通过同的加密方式实现对php数据安全的加密扩展。今天我们就来学习一下centos7下如何安装php7的openssl扩展。今天运行将laravel项目放在新的服务器上,需

    2022-02-23 17:38点击阅读

  • 了解优化PHP7性能的几个设置

    本篇文章带大家了解一下优化PHP7性能的几个设置。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。PHP7已经发布了, 作为PHP10年来最大的版本升级, 最大的性能升级, PHP7在多放的测试中都表现出很明显的性能提升,

    2022-02-23 17:38点击阅读

  • php7如何使用xhprof分析

    本篇文章给大家介绍一下php7使用xhprof分析的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。这是篇纯文档,如果以后有需要可以随时查找, 使用 xhprof 进行分析, 方便代码测试、对比分析(支持php7).前

    2022-02-23 17:38点击阅读

  • PHP7下如何安装并使用xhprof性能分析工具

    本篇文章给大家介绍一下PHP7下安装并使用xhprof性能分析工具的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。该 xhprof 版本是从 https://github.com/longxinH/xhprof 获取

    2022-02-23 17:38点击阅读

  • PHP7.2源码如何进行安装

    本篇文章给大家介绍一下PHP7.2源码进行安装的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。一、下载php7.2版本的安装包1.下载2.上传到服务器的root目录pwd:查看当前目录ll:查看当前目录下的文件二.解

    2022-02-23 17:38点击阅读

  • PHP7下如何安装memcache和memcached扩展

    memcache和memcached都是Memcached服务器的PHP扩展。其中memcache比memcached早出现,所以一些老的代码可能还在用memcache扩展。可以根据自己需要,安装一个即可。这里两个的安装方法都说一下。Mem

    2022-02-23 17:38点击阅读

  • PHP7如何使用set_error_handler和set_exception_handler处理异常机制

    本篇文章给大家介绍一下PHP7使用set_error_handler和set_exception_handler处理异常机制的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。由于历史原因,php一开始被设计为一门面向过

    2022-02-23 17:38点击阅读

  • php7怎么安装 mbstring 扩展

    php7安装mbstring扩展的方法:首先进入到源码包“ext/mbstring”目录下;然后运行phpize并安装基础包;接着修改配置信息;最后重启php-fpm服务即可。本文操作环境:Windows7系统、PHP7.1版,DELL G

    2022-02-23 17:38点击阅读

  • php7+中如何使用openssl替代mcrypt进行AES加密解密

    本篇文章给大家介绍一下php7+中使用openssl替代mcrypt进行AES加密解密的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。mcrypt十年过去,现在php7+中已经开始淘汰。官方给出掉提示:mcrypt_

    2022-02-23 17:38点击阅读

  • PHP7如何实现AES/ECB/PKCS5Padding加密

    本篇文章给大家介绍一下PHP7实现AES/ECB/PKCS5Padding加密的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。class CryptAES{ /** * var string $metho

    2022-02-23 17:38点击阅读

  • php7如何开启强类型模式

    本篇文章给大家介绍一下php7开启强类型模式的方法。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。我们知道php是一种弱类型的编程语言,但是php7已经有所改变,可以支持代码开启强类型模式了,好消息。php7开启强类型模式

    2022-02-23 17:38点击阅读